Talking of Hangeland, does anyone remember a time before H & H? It used to be that every season we were crying out for even one decent CB and then we got 2 excellent ones! How wonderful have they been? They have almost expunged all memories of Zesh Rehman et al and Zat Knight has gone on to be a decent Prem player! You just never know what's around the corner in this game. So, thank you Aaron and Brede for getting me off the beta blockers and giving us some real moments of smile at the memory class.

"does anyone remember a time before H & H?"

Only too well! (And I wouldn't have Zat Knight back as a gift.) We weren't badly off if one went back a little further, though, with Chris Coleman, Trollope and Kit Symond.

What was the name of that guy we bought off Portsmouth and eventually offloaded to Norwich, I think. He must have been the worst Fulham CB since the days of Bill Dodgin.

I think there should be a special award to Aaron Hughes. He is unlikely to be the Club's player of the year (though so far I can't see a better option this season), but over the last few seasons he has without doubt been our most consistently good player. I just hope that Hughes has no plans to replace him with Samba, though I've no doubt that Brede and Samba would be a terrifying pair of centre backs for most opposition teams.
